KeyBS signs franchise agreement with KBS Qatar


January 6, 2015 | By RetailME Bureau

KeyBS, a technology provider for financial institutions and member of Arabi Holding Group KSC, has entered into a franchise agreement with KBS Qatar. As part of this contract KBS Qatar will be the exclusive franchisee for KeyKIOSK and KeyPOS in Qatar, and will install 100 KeyKIOSK and 500 POS within the first year.

Making the announcement, Ibrahim Darraz, KeyBS managing director, comments, “This agreement is in keeping with our expansion strategy in the GCC. Qatar is a very significant market for us and we are delighted to partner with KBS Qatar that is well placed to drive our growth in this key market. Qatar, like the rest of the GCC, is witnessing strong demand from consumers for automated and digital payment solutions. This has necessitated banks, exchange houses and other financial institutes to swiftly respond to this growing demand, thus creating unprecedented opportunities for a company like ours. Industry research shows that over the next five years more than two-thirds of customers are like to be self-directed.”

KeyBS has already installed 25 kiosk machines in Qatar, and it expects to reach 75 machines in the country by April, 2015. Continuing its expansion, KeyBS recently hit a new milestone reaching 565 locations all over GCC covering the UAE, Qatar, Bahrain and KSA. Across its network, the company offers more than 15 services in 10 different languages. Comparing KeyBS’ 2014 results with 2013, its turnover increased by 800%, while the number of its transactions rose by 1250%. The company is looking to reach around 880 locations in the emirates and GCC by first half of 2015.
